数据库字段名称的含义解析
数据库的字段名是指在数据库表中用来标识和存储数据的列的名称。字段名通常由字母、数字和下划线组成,且必须唯一且具有描述性。字段名在数据库设计中起到非常重要的作用,它们不仅用于标识每个列的唯一性,还能够提供对数据的描述和理解。以下是字段名的几个重要意义:
-
标识数据类型:字段名通常与数据类型相关联,比如“age”表示年龄,这样就能够清楚地知道该字段存储的是一个整数类型的数据。字段名的命名应该能够准确地反映数据类型,方便数据库管理员和开发人员进行数据操作和查询。
-
提供数据描述:字段名应该能够提供对数据的描述,使得用户能够直观地理解该字段存储的数据内容。比如在一个学生表中,可以使用字段名“student_name”来描述学生的姓名,这样在查询时就能够直观地知道该字段存储的是学生的姓名信息。
-
约束数据完整性:字段名可以用于约束数据的完整性和一致性。通过给字段名赋予有意义的命名,可以帮助开发人员在数据插入和更新时进行数据验证,从而确保数据的有效性和准确性。比如在一个用户表中,可以使用字段名“email”来存储用户的电子邮箱地址,这样就能够在数据插入时进行合法性验证。
-
支持数据查询和分析:字段名的命名应该能够支持数据查询和分析操作。通过合理的字段名命名,可以提高查询语句的可读性和可维护性,减少开发人员的工作量。比如在一个销售订单表中,可以使用字段名“order_date”来存储订单的日期信息,这样在查询时就能够直观地知道该字段存储的是订单的日期。
-
提高代码的可读性和可维护性:字段名的命名应该符合代码的编码规范,能够提高代码的可读性和可维护性。合理的字段名能够使其他开发人员快速理解和修改代码,减少出错的概率。比如在一个商品表中,可以使用字段名“product_price”来存储商品的价格信息,这样就能够清晰地知道该字段存储的是商品的价格。
数据库的字段名是指在数据库表中定义的列的名称。它用于标识和描述表中每个列存储的数据的含义和特征。字段名在数据库中起着非常重要的作用,它可以用来唯一地标识表中的每个列,使得数据的存储和检索更加方便和高效。
字段名通常由字母、数字和下划线组成,并且有一定的命名规范。常见的命名规范包括以下几点:
-
字段名应具有描述性:字段名应该能够清晰地表达该字段所存储的数据的含义和特征。例如,如果一个字段存储的是用户的姓名,则可以将其命名为“user_name”。
-
字段名应具有一致性:字段名在整个数据库中应该保持一致,避免使用不同的名称来表示相同的含义。这样可以减少混淆和错误,并提高数据库的可维护性。
-
字段名应具有可读性:字段名应该易于阅读和理解,避免使用过于复杂或晦涩的名称。这样可以方便开发人员和数据库管理员理解和操作数据库。
-
字段名应具有唯一性:字段名在表中应该是唯一的,不同的字段应该有不同的名称。这样可以确保在查询和操作数据库时不会发生冲突和混淆。
字段名的选择对于数据库的设计和使用非常重要。一个好的字段名可以提高数据库的可读性、可维护性和性能,同时也可以减少错误和混淆的可能性。因此,在设计数据库表时,应该仔细考虑字段名的选择,并遵循一定的命名规范。
数据库的字段名是指在数据库表中定义的列名,用来表示表中的各个属性或字段。每个字段都有一个唯一的名称,以便在查询和操作数据库时能够准确地引用和使用这些字段。
字段名的命名通常遵循一些规范和约定,以确保字段名的可读性和一致性。以下是一些常见的字段命名规范和约定:
-
尽量使用具有描述性的字段名:字段名应该能够清晰地描述该字段所表示的含义。例如,如果一个字段表示学生的姓名,则可以将其命名为"student_name"或"full_name",而不是简单的"n"或"name"。
-
使用小写字母和下划线:字段名通常使用小写字母和下划线来分隔单词,以提高可读性。例如,"first_name"和"last_name"。
-
避免使用保留字:数据库系统通常有一些保留字,用于表示特定的功能或命令。为了避免冲突,应该避免使用这些保留字作为字段名。
-
一致性:在整个数据库中,相同类型的字段应该使用相同的命名约定。例如,如果一个表中有多个日期字段,可以使用"create_date"和"update_date"来表示创建日期和更新日期。
-
使用简洁而具有描述性的字段名:字段名应该尽量简洁,但仍然能够准确地描述字段的含义。避免使用过长或冗余的字段名。
在定义数据库表时,需要为每个字段指定一个字段名,并指定字段的数据类型、长度、约束等属性。字段名是数据库表中数据存储和查询的基础,因此良好的字段名命名可以提高数据库的可读性、维护性和查询效率。